What can you use the application for?
Geckogo.com is a collaborative travel planning resource for independent travelers. Designed for travelers who do not wish to travel as part of a group, the site has user-contributed content about travel destinations all over the world. The site also mixes social networking with travel information, with profiles, friends, messaging, user-contributed content such as tips, guides and information about destinations, and community forums. Users get points for sharing information about places they’ve been. The site has a convenient top menu bar for navigation. The menu bar includes tabs such as Home, which brings up the Geckogo home page. The Destination page allows you to search for destinations based on their interests, such as scuba diving or visiting museums. The Tips page consists of user-contributed tips for various destinations. The Answers page allows users to post questions about destinations to be answered by other users. The Contribute page is where users can add their favorite destinations to the site. Users can choose to add a Travel Tip, Sites and Attractions, Restaurants and Cafes, Lodging, Nightlife or Other Resources for a particular destination. The Services page provides convenient search utilities for Hotels, Insurance, Flights and Travel Guides. The Travel Guides page has a selection of Bradt Travel guides for sale for many popular destinations. The Community page gives access to the site’s forums, which include General, Travel Deals, Tours and Tour Operators, Volunteering and Working Abroad, Sustainable Travel, Off Topic and Feedback and Bugs. The My World page is the user’s home page, and gives access to their Profile, Friends, Favorites, and Messaging.
What is the history and popularity of the application?
Geckogo.com was founded in 2007 by a group of avid travelers, including Aaron Chow, Eric MacKinnon and Pokin Yeung. The site has undergone steady growth since launch, and currently serves tens of thousands of unique monthly visitors. The site has a current Alexa page rank below 75,000. The site is done in partnership with Bradt Travel Guides.
What are the differences to other applications?
Competition to Geckogo.com comes from the major travel sites such as Expedia, Orbitz and Travelocity. In contrast to these sites, the focus of Geckogo is on the destinations, rather than searching the web for deals on travel and lodging. Geckogo offers some unique user-contributed content about most destinations that cannot be found on the major travel sites. Geckogo is best for researching what to do and where to stay in a particular destination, while the major travel sites are better for finding deals on travel and lodging.
How does the application look and feel to use?
The Geckogo.com site has a clean and uncluttered look and feel. Navigation is intuitive and page loads are quite responsive. The interface for adding content is user friendly and there are convenient search utilities for most areas of the site. There is no advertising displayed on the site.
How does the registration process work?
Registration to Geckogo.com is free and is not required to view most of the content on the site. Registration is required to contribute content, have a profile, favorites, and friends and to participate in the community forums. The registration process asks for first and last name, email address, password and gender. Users can optionally add the cities they have visited to earn extra points, and upload a photo for their profile. Validation of the email address is required.
What does it cost to use the application?
Registration to Geckogo.com is free and there is no premium membership offered to the site.
Who would you recommend the application to?
Geckogo.com is recommended to independent travelers worldwide. There is a wealth of information about many popular as well as out of the way destinations to be found on the site. Content is growing daily, as the site adds users and existing users add more content. The site is recommended as a resource to anyone who is planning to travel to a destination alone, and not as part of a group or tour.
